Yemen official says Houthis declined to receive covid-19 vaccine shipment

Aden - Sabanet
A Yemeni Public Health official said the Houthi militants have declined to receive a shipment of covid-19 vaccines to distribute it amongst the endangered people in their areas of control in north of the country.
Deputy Health Minister Ali Al-Walidi a told WHO-sponsored virtual meeting of Mediterranean health ministers that the Sana’a-based militia has refused to receive the vaccine shipment despite the danger the novel.
He said that the Houthi years long war has caused not insecurity and displacements but also the collapse of the country’s health system which expedite the proliferation of epidemics and diseases.
